Area roundup: Seahawks start season off with 2 wins

Bishop Seabury’s boys basketball team picked up a pair of wins in its first two games of the season.

The Seahawks played on consecutive days, starting with a 75-29 home victory over St. Mary’s Thursday and then claiming a 63-56 win at Hanover on Friday. Entering the season, Bishop Seabury was the No. 4 team in Class 2A via the preseason coaches poll, while Hanover was listed at No. 2 in 1A.

Stavian Jones and Zach Bloch each had 18 points to lead Bishop Seabury to a victory over a ranked foe Friday. Luke Hornberger dominated the glass to lift the Seahawks to their second consecutive victory.

Meanwhile, Cobe Green paced the Seahawks in the season opener with a career-high 26 points.

Veritas 63, Heritage Christian 38

The Veritas boys basketball team started the year off with a 63-38 win over Heritage Christian.

Tucker Flory led the team with 21 points in 24 minutes, hitting 10 of his 15 shot attempts in the win. Trey Huslig added 12 points for the Eagles, while Scott Weinhold chipped in 11 points in the season opener.

Veritas jumped out to a 15-4 advantage in the first period before adding a 22-point outburst in the second quarter to pull away.

Eudora 54, Basehor-Linwood 47

Eudora’s girls basketball team took care of business in the season opener, claiming a 54-47 win over Basehor-Linwood.

Basehor-Linwood jumped out to a 20-16 advantage in the first period before Eudora added 15 points in the second quarter and 17 in the final period. Riley Hiebert and Harper Schreiner each added 18 points for the Cardinals. Reagan Hiebert finished with 13 points.

Eudora will compete in the Paola Invitational next week, which begins Monday.
